#666da2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#666da2 is composed of 40% red, 42.7% green and 63.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 37% cyan, 32.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 36.5% black. It has a hue angle of 233 degrees, a saturation of 24.4% and a lightness of 51.8%. #666da2 color hex could be obtained by blending #ccdaff with #000045. Closest websafe color is: #666699.

#666da2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#666da2 has RGB values of R:102, G:109, B:162 and CMYK values of C:0.37, M:0.33, Y:0, K:0.36. Its decimal value is 6712738.
